Don't like ads? PRO users don't see any ads ;-)
Guest

Untitled

By: a guest on Aug 20th, 2012  |  syntax: None  |  size: 0.94 KB  |  hits: 4  |  expires: Never
download  |  raw  |  embed  |  report abuse  |  print
Text below is selected. Please press Ctrl+C to copy to your clipboard. (⌘+C on Mac)
  1. #!/bin/sh
  2. cd $(dirname $0)
  3.  
  4. echo \>\> Setting Up APT Sources
  5. cat > /etc/apt/sources.list <<END
  6. deb http://mirrors.kernel.org/debian/ squeeze main contrib non-free
  7. deb http://mirrors.kernel.org/debian/ squeeze-updates main contrib non-free
  8. deb http://security.debian.org/ squeeze/updates main contrib non-free
  9. deb http://packages.dotdeb.org squeeze all
  10. END
  11.  
  12. echo \>\> Updating APT
  13. wget http://www.dotdeb.org/dotdeb.gpg -qO - | apt-key add -
  14. apt-get update
  15.  
  16. echo \>\> Cleaning Package States
  17. echo > /var/lib/apt/extended_states
  18. echo > /var/lib/aptitude/pkgstates
  19. rm /var/lib/aptitude/pkgstates.old
  20.  
  21. echo \>\> Purging Non Minimal Packages
  22. sh minimal.sh
  23.  
  24. echo \>\> Setting Up Dropbear
  25. sed -i -e 's/NO_START=1/NO_START=0/g' /etc/default/dropbear
  26.  
  27. echo \>\> Setting Settings
  28. echo "unset HISTFILE" >> /etc/profile
  29. dpkg-reconfigure tzdata
  30.  
  31. echo \>\> Setting Skel
  32. rm -rf /etc/skel/.*
  33. rm -rf ~/.*
  34. cp -R skel/.* /etc/skel/
  35. cp -R /etc/skel/.* ~